The Děčín Thermal Zone and the Saint Joseph's Spa

The article sums up the information on the spa in Děčín-Dolní Žleb which was established in 1768 and ceased to exist in 1922. The spa's location is examined in contest with the Děčín Thermal Zone as it is known today. The decrease of output and temperature of the healing water probably results from tectonic uplifts that largely influence the ground water circulation.
